Why Attic Retrofits Matter In The Central Valley
From Fresno to nearby valley towns, summer afternoons often reach the high 90s or more. The sun heats your roof, the roof heats the attic, and the attic then radiates heat into ceilings. Without enough insulation and air sealing, that heat load drives up cooling time and stresses equipment.
A code-aligned attic retrofit does three things homeowners notice right away. Rooms feel less “stuffy” in the afternoon. AC runtimes shorten because ceilings gain less heat. And temperature swings between upstairs and downstairs shrink, which means you can set the thermostat and forget it.
Local insight: During extended Central Valley heat waves, attic temperatures can exceed 140°F. Upgrading insulation and sealing key leaks reduces heat flow before it reaches your living space, which helps keep comfort steady in late afternoon and evening.
What Title 24 Requires For Attic Insulation In California
Title 24, Part 6 sets statewide energy efficiency rules. For attics, it lists minimum insulation levels that vary by climate zone. Central Valley zones typically require higher attic R-values than coastal areas. Exact numbers can change with code updates and by jurisdiction, so always verify the current prescriptive table with your local building department or energy consultant.
Here is how our team treats compliance in simple, practical terms:
- Confirm your climate zone and required attic R-value from the current Title 24 table.
- Select an insulation type and installed thickness that reliably meets or exceeds that R-value.
- Use depth markers and manufacturer coverage charts to document target coverage across the attic.
- Keep clearances at vents, flues, and fixtures to meet safety and product requirements.
- Provide documentation for inspections; additional verification may be required based on project scope.
Pro tip: Always match the labeled R-value to installed depth and settled density. That is how you get the performance you paid for across the whole season.
Real-World Performance: Cellulose Vs Fiberglass In Hot-Dry Climates
Both cellulose and fiberglass can meet Title 24 when installed correctly. Real homes in hot-dry regions like the Central Valley show meaningful differences in how materials behave, especially around gaps, wiring, and odd joist bays. The key is full, even coverage that stops convective looping and limits radiant heat transfer from the attic deck.
Many homeowners ask about “cellulose vs fiberglass blown in insulation Central Valley.” Here is a plain-language comparison to guide the conversation with your installer:
- Coverage and Fit: Blown-in cellulose packs densely around obstacles and can reduce small air pathways. Fiberglass batts are uniform but rely on a perfect fit in each bay. Blown-in fiberglass offers better coverage than batts in irregular spaces.
- Thermal Stability: Both reach code R-values when installed to the right depth. Dense materials tend to limit air movement within the insulation layer, which helps during long, hot afternoons.
- Moisture and Indoor Air: Cellulose is treated for fire and pests. Fiberglass is inert and non-absorbent. Either material needs proper attic ventilation to manage moisture from the home below.
- Settling and Maintenance: Properly installed cellulose includes an allowance for natural settling. Fiberglass blown-in settles less but still requires verified coverage. In both cases, depth markers help confirm performance over time.
Important: Material choice is only half the battle. The biggest gains come from air sealing around top plates, chases, and penetrations before adding insulation. Those hidden gaps can undermine even high R-values if left open.
How Attic Retrofits Lower Cooling Bills And Ease HVAC Strain
An underinsulated attic acts like a hot radiator above your ceiling. Upgrading to a code-aligned R-value cuts the rate of heat flowing into rooms, so the thermostat stays satisfied longer. That shortens AC cycles and reduces daily runtime, which typically lowers electric use on peak days.
It also protects your equipment. Lower attic heat gain means supply ducts in the attic operate closer to design temperature. Compressors cycle less often, which can support longer service life. Many homeowners also notice quieter operation because their system is not racing to chase those late-day spikes.

Choosing The Right Material And R‑Value For Your Home
Think of R-value like the thickness of a shade cloth between your rooms and the attic. A higher R-value slows heat flow more. California’s climate zones assign minimums so homeowners have a baseline. Many Central Valley homes benefit from going a bit above the minimum when feasible to handle longer heat waves and roof exposures.
Material choice depends on attic layout, current conditions, and goals. For open attics with lots of wiring and odd angles, blown-in cellulose or blown-in fiberglass can create continuous coverage. For simple, uniform joist bays without many obstructions, high-quality fiberglass batts installed to a snug fit can also perform well. The best path is the one that achieves even coverage at the right depth while keeping safety clearances intact.
Safety note: Keep insulation away from heat sources and maintain manufacturer clearances. Also verify that any recessed lights in the ceiling below are appropriately rated if insulation will contact or cover them.
Signs You May Need Attic Insulation Replacement
Energy code updates, roof work, or past pest activity can leave your attic below current standards. Look for these common clues and then schedule a professional inspection:
- Uneven temperatures between rooms, especially late afternoon or early evening
- Visible ceiling joists or patchy coverage when you peek at the attic hatch
- Dusty or dark streaks where air leaks have carried particles through the insulation
- Long AC runtimes or short cycling during typical summer days
Remember, proper performance is about the system. Air sealing, safe ventilation, and consistent depth work together. That is why we bundle them into one integrated scope, so your attic performs as designed.
